Driving License Application (Führerscheinantrag) in German Driving Theory

The Führerscheinantrag, or Driving License Application, is the formal request you submit to the local German driving license authority (Führerscheinstelle) to initiate your journey toward obtaining a German driving license. This crucial administrative step is a prerequisite for both your theoretical and practical driving tests, making it essential to understand early in your driving school process. It involves gathering various documents and undergoing checks to confirm you meet all legal eligibility requirements, laying the groundwork for your entire driver training. Timely submission is key, as processing times can vary significantly.

What is the Führerscheinantrag in Germany?

The Führerscheinantrag is the official application required to obtain a German driving license. It's a mandatory step that aspiring drivers must complete with their local driving license authority (Führerscheinstelle) before they can proceed to take the theory and practical driving exams.

What documents are needed for a German Driving License Application?

Typically, you will need a biometric passport photo, an eye test certificate (Sehtestbescheinigung), a certificate of participation in a first aid course (Erste-Hilfe-Kurs), and a valid form of identification. Your driving school will also provide information to include.

When should I submit my Führerscheinantrag?

It is highly recommended to submit your application as early as possible after enrolling in a driving school. Processing times can range from four to eight weeks, and your application must be approved before you can register for the official theory or practical driving tests.

Where do I submit the Führerscheinantrag in Germany?

You submit the Führerscheinantrag to your local driving license authority, known as the Führerscheinstelle. This office is usually part of the Landratsamt or the city administration (Straßenverkehrsamt) in your place of residence.

Can I take my German theory exam before my application is approved?

No, the approval of your Führerscheinantrag is a prerequisite for taking both the theory and practical driving exams in Germany. Your driving school will only be able to register you for the tests once the application has been processed and approved by the Führerscheinstelle.
